Job Description:


The Sr. Specialist, Supplier Quality Engineer (SQE) is responsible for ensuring that delivered products and services conform to contractual obligations and Company requirements. The SQE will work closely with assigned suppliers on activities such as Early Supplier Engagements, First Article Inspections, Root Cause/Corrective Action initiatives, and audits. The SQE will also collaborate with the assigned Contract Source Inspector to ensure product releases are timely and meet internal customer expectations. Up to 80% travel is required.

Essential Functions:


25% – Visit suppliers to review product and process issues. Interface with internal and external customers (engineering, manufacturing, suppliers, procurement) to ensure requirements are met. Analyze supplier processes and planning to verify compliance with purchase orders, engineering drawings, processes, and specifications. Review and approve supplier First Article Inspections in accordance with AS9102.

25% – Visit suppliers to conduct investigations and root cause analyses to drive continuous improvement. Be accountable for assigned suppliers’ performance and ensure they maintain a 100% quality rating.

15% – Serve as an active contributor in Early Supplier Engagements, including Post Award Reviews (PAR), Supplier Manufacturing Readiness Reviews, and Control Plan development. Perform as the lead contributor for PAR‑Lite activities.

15% – Work with suppliers to resolve issues with purchase order inspection packages. Investigate and report supplier quality history as requested by Quality Engineering or Quality & Mission Assurance (Q&MA) management.

10% – Create reporting documents to summarize supplier performance, nonconformance history, impacts to the Company’s Cost of Poor Quality (CoPQ), and other assigned metrics.

5% – Participate in managing the supplier ratings/scorecard system and support periodic supplier performance meetings.

5% – Perform periodic source inspections at assigned suppliers.
